On Do, 12 Sep 2013, Marc Glisse wrote:
  /etc/texmf/web2c/updmap.cfg

Did you create this file? It should not be there unless you
consciously generated it.

I didn't consciously create it. It says it was auto-generated by update-updmap, in May 2012. It contains the basic stuff (lm-*.map and qXX.map), plus extra entries for musixtex.cfg cm-super.cfg cm-super-minimal.cfg tipa.cfg, I don't know if some other package somehow created it.

If there is nothing in there, please remove it (or better,
rename it).

After removing this file, I could purge musixtex with no problem, thanks.

So I guess the only question is how I ended up with that file (I didn't do any customization). I guess unless other people have it as well you can close the bug and assume I messed up something (or some old version of some package did).
